Beyond the translation

Overall song meaning

This song uses philosophical imagery rooted in Siddhar philosophy to ponder the ephemeral nature of life, human relationships, and physical existence. The recurring metaphor of the 'empty asafoetida box' (Kaali perungaaya dappaa) symbolizes how human life retains the lingering residual scent of worldly ties and ego even after its core substance or vitality is gone. The lyrics stress that human effort does not control involuntary biological processes like heartbeats or blood circulation, underscoring human helplessness before nature and fate.

Writing craft

Poetic devices

Metaphor (Uvamai / Uvamaanam)

Kaali perungaaya dappaa / Adhula vaasana balamaa thaan irukku

Comparing human life/body to an empty asafoetida box that retains smell despite being empty.

Rhyme / Assonance (Edhukai & Mouna)

Dhegam adhu sandhaegam / Indha kaayam adhu vengaayam

Use of internal rhyming and rhythmic pairing of Tamil words like Dhegam (body) and Sandhaegam (doubt), and Kaayam (body) and Vengaayam (onion).

Simile (Uvamai)

Naan oru thani maram pol / Thavichu thallaadi vizhuven

Comparing oneself to a lonely tree standing vulnerable in the open ('thani maram pol').

Did you know?

Trivia

The metaphor 'Kaali perungaaya dappaa' (an empty asafoetida container) is a classical Tamil proverb frequently used in Siddhar poetry and philosophical discourses to describe someone or something that retains prestige, memory, or arrogance long after the actual power or value has faded.
